Why Are Pre Purchase Building Inspections Are Important

You’ve found one that looks like it’s got everything you want. The real estate agent reckons it’s solidly constructed and your DIY professional acquaintance says it’s great. Do you really need to get it checked out?

If you’re buying a home without doing a pre purchase inspection, not only could you be left with costly problems that could be identified, but it could also severely limit the possibility of pursuing damages if the home was to be stricken with an issue of significant importance.

A pre purchase inspection report prepared by an qualified Aotea building inspector will reveal any issues the property is suffering from, and will also highlight any future problems , and indicate points that will add value. This assures home buyers don’t have unpleasant unexpected costs and gives you the opportunity to negotiate a lower cost.

We examine the entire structure and look for any serious flaws and any urgent maintenance problems and issues that are caused by the gradual degradation. We are looking for structural issues or signs that the house is in require of repair, issues caused by deferred maintenance such as weatherboards turning rotten because of peeling paint, and areas where there is damp or mould.

Red Flags & Warning Signs

Each of these could be expensive to sort out:

Black plastic piping: You should look for them if the home was constructed or re-plumbed around the late 1970s to early 1980s. They have been known to leak. Insurance companies won’t cover any damages caused by this pipe even if you were aware that they were there.

Weatherside cladding: This weatherboard can leak. If the household was built in the early 80s , it could be equipped with Weatherside.

Cladding made of Plaster: Used in the 1980s to the mid-2000s Many "leaky houses" have this cladding. Exterior walls typically have an unbroken or smooth appearance.

Asbestos construction: It was widely used from the around the mid-1940s up to the mid-1980s. It may be in roofs, ceilings under lino, fencing. If you find asbestos in the property, seek expert advice on what risk it poses, how it can be removed the time it would require to remove, as well as the cost for removal.

Does this change require an approval from the building department? Complete building inspection reports can uncover what building work doesn't have a building permit.

Buying a Home Or Commercial Building?

Pre-Purchase Building & House Inspections Aotea

Our detailed pre purchase inspection will pinpoint any areas which may require some attention.

  • An in-depth assessment of the structure and weather-tightness of all visible components.
  • A study for the solutions that the house receives (given reasonable access).
  • A cursory survey of out-buildings along with the immediate site and grounds drainage.
  • Non-invasive moisture testing areas of high-risk and potential problems like door and window penetrations as well as wet rooms (bathrooms laundry, bathrooms etc.) is an integral part of the service offered.
  • Identification of maintenance related items.
  • Recognising additions and modifications post original construction requiring the approval of a permit or permission.
